This is the full case to enclose a Gizmo Revision Version 1.0/1.1 robot controller with greater access to I/O Ports and an integrated power switch. The main case body has 5 parts:
Light pipes, part number LFC063CTP can be inserted to make the Main Gizmo LEDs more visible once the case is put on.
A standard KCD1 Rocker Switch can be used as the power switch.
7 screws can be added to hold the case together. These can be either M3 x 10mm Flat Head Hex Socket Bolts, or standard self-drilling #6 screws, ½ inch with flat head.
Alternatively, a case with labels can be used, if your printer supports fine resolution and multiple colors. The raw SVG for labels are there if you can use those with your slicer, or if you need to stack meshes, use:
If you use Blender, the full .blend file for this project is also available in files. No final mods have been applied in the model, allowing tweaks to carve out sub assemblies to allow resizing and repositioning of almost any surface. Full materials have also been defined in the file so it can be viewed in a full color render
